Mullite Price in Australia (CIF) - 2022
The average mullite import price stood at $386 per ton in 2022, growing by 6.2% against the previous year. In general, import price indicated a buoyant increase from 2012 to 2022: its price increased at an average annual rate of +5.5% over the last decade.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, mullite import price increased by +90.5% against 2014 indices.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2015 an increase of 33% against the previous year. The import price peaked in 2022 and is likely to continue growth in years to come.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2022,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Germany ($562 per ton), while the price for the United States ($347 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by China (+7.9%).
Mullite Price in Australia (FOB) - 2022
The average mullite export price stood at $719 per ton in 2022, growing by 19%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the export price, however, showed a pronounced downturn. The export price peaked at $1,140 per ton in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, the export pr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
As there is only one major export destination, the average price level is determined by prices for New Zealand.
From 2012 to 2022, the rate of growth in terms of prices for New Zealand amounted to +3.2% per year.
Mullite Imports in Australia
After two years of decline, supplies from abroad of mullites increased by 65% to 9.6K tons in 2022. Overall, total imports indicated a remarkable increase from 2019 to 2022: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+12.9% over the last three-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. As a result, imports attained the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, mullite imports soared to $3.7M in 2022. Over the period under review, total imports indicated resilient growth from 2019 to 2022: its value increased at an average annual rate of +18.4% over the last three-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. As a result, imports attained the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
Import of Mullite in Australia (Thousand USD) |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
COUNTRY | 2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| CAGR, 2019-2022 |
United States | 2,011 | 2,054 | 1,419 | 2,683 | 10.1% |
China | 194 | 194 | 617 | 885 | 65.8% |
Germany | N/A | N/A | N/A | 95.6 | 0% |
South Africa | 11.8 | 9.7 | 7.6 | N/A | -19.7% |
Others | 8.5 | 78.8 | 65.8 | 29.1 | 50.7% |
Total | 2,225 | 2,336 | 2,109 | 3,693 | 18.4% |
Top Suppliers of Mullite to Australia in 2022:
- United States (7.7K tons)
- China (1.6K tons)
- Germany (0.2K tons)
